> For celery executor, airflow keeps the AsyncResult in memory for the duration 
> of the task, then deletes when task completes (success or fail).
> This can make troubleshooting failed tasks hard – trying to figure out which 
> task instance is which "celery task" in Flower, etc.
> It would be a lot easier if there was a "Task Instance id" that could be 
> populated with the AsyncResult.id for celery, or otherwise a UID for other 
> executors.
